SUGAR LAND--August 6, 2014--Researched by Industrial Info Resources (Sugar Land, Texas)--Polyethylene, one of the most common derivatives produced from ethylene, is a versatile plastic with a variety of uses, including packaging, automotive, construction materials and electronics. With all the large ethylene capacity projects that have been announced during the last few years in North America, it was only a matter of time before a wave of downstream derivative projects would be announced. In the U.S. and Canada, Industrial Info is tracking 30 active capital projects with a total value of about $6 billion that are planned in polyethylene units.
